Two workers electrocuted

Staff Correspondent
A female worker of a plastic factory at Kamrangirchar and an electrician in Tejgaon were electrocuted in two separate incidents in the capital yesterday. At Kamrangirchar, the victim was identified as Shefali Begum, 30, wife of Abdur Rahim and a worker of Parvez Plastic Factory. While working, a part of Shefali's saree got entangled with a running floor fan. When she tried to untangle her saree, her hand came into contact with a snapped wire, Abdur Rahim told reporters. Co-workers rushed her to Dhaka Medical College Hospital (DMCH) where she succumbed to her injuries, he added. Meanwhile, electrician Ripon, 20, was electrocuted while welding at the ground floor of a four-storied building at West Tejturibazar of Tejgaon. Workers rushed him to DMCH where he was declared dead.
